Woman Faces Trial for Fatal 2020 Crash Involving Alleged Facetime Call

A 27-year-old Verona woman, Alexi Garbi, has pleaded not guilty to the charge of Aggravated Use of an Electronic Communication Device/ Death, a class four felony. Her case will be determined by a bench trial in front of Grundy County Judge Scott Belt on May 10th.

Garbi was involved in a two-vehicle accident on June 2nd, 2020, at the intersection of West Grand Ridge Road and South Verona Road. Sheriff Ken Briley reported that Ellen Hack, 65, was extricated from her vehicle, which was on fire at the time of the incident. Hack passed away on June 19th, 2020, due to her injuries.

Investigators allege Garbi was conducting a Facetime call on her electronic communication device while operating a vehicle, leading to the crash that killed Hack. Garbi remains free on a $20,000 bond.
